As for the drive, I'm 6'1 185lbs. Never had any seating issues with my back or legs. My next town commute was never more than 5hrs or 300mi. Check Engine Light appeared about 2000 miles in AND 150 after oil change. My guess was a sea level car used to humidity is now operating at elevation and much drier air. Motor and all associated gauges were in line. After 5 days and now in Dallas for 4 days, I book an appointment at dealer. That morning to run it over upon cranking, CEL is off.
The only downside on trip is traversing crappy roads. The car is very darty on uneven, crater like back roads. Out West, everything is rough. Rocks. Dirt. Sand. Dust. Forget about wiping car down if windy. I drove mainly between 8a and 4pm. I10, I25, I40 and state roads.
The upside is the car is a total blast to drive on decent roads. Especially with the windows down. Weather was fantastic. 70's in the day. 50's at night. Only rain was leaving Florida and returning.
